Local Government Poll: Afon Constituency to Vote massively for APC

Date: 2017-10-24

Stakeholders of All Progressives Congress(APC) in Afon Constituency of Asa Local Government have resolved to work together and ensure that the Party garnered overwhelming votes in the forthcoming Local Government Election in the area.

The resolution followed the Constituency meeting initiated by a member representing Afon Constituency, Hon Mohammed Mobolaji Amosa at Afon, headquarters of Asa Local Government Area.

Speaking at the meeting attended by most party faithfuls in the area, Hon. Amosa who praised the hierarchy of the Party in the State, for zoning the chairmanship position to the Constituency, said the peace meeting became imperative, to enable the party reenact massive vote which the Constituency was noted for in general elections.

Hon. Amosa enumerated the achievements of the party, in the area, and praised the Senate President and other stakeholders for the on going construction of Afon-Aboto-Oyo State boundary road project, by the federal Government and other on going projects in the area.

In their separate remarks, the former Chairmen of Asa Local Government Council, Dr Muftau Yahaya, Chief David Akinola, former Chairmen of the State Scholarship Board Alh. Saadu Ajelanwa, Hon Isiaka Mogaji, Commissioner 3 in the State Civil Service Commission Alh. Isiaka Labaeka praised the hierarchy of the Party in the state, as well as the state government for the numerous on going and completed projects in the areas of road, water, street lights, rural roads and enjoined the people of Afon Constituency to reciprocate by voting massively for the APC in the November's council polls in the state.

They described the lawmaker as a worthy ambassador, who is genuinely committed towards the wellbeing and progress of his Constituency, and enjoined other political office holders to imbibe his sterling qualities to further make democracy more responsive to the demands of the electorate.

Also speaking, the APC chairmanship candidate in the Local Government Hajia Risikat Opakunle, while speaking on behalf of other contestants promised to be more responsive to the yearnings and aspirations of the people, if elected, in the forthcoming Local Government election.

Earlier the Vice Chairman of the Party in the Local Government Area, Alhaji Safi Isiaka, noted that the Constituency had benefitted tremendously from the ruling Party and enjoined the people of the area, to reciprocate the gesture, by voting massively for the party in the election.
